horn stems clenchable? by guacamoolah in PipeTobacco

[–]carnesy 4 points5 points  (0 children)

I have several horn stemmed pipes, including ropps, and while the buttons do feel clunky I'm able to clench them no problem. Though I'm simply using my lower teeth as a balancing fulcrum point and my top ones as a counter lever to stop it from tipping out of my mouth. I'm not chomping and biting down very hard.

Looking to Purchase a Briar by gsteppin in PipeTobacco

[–]carnesy 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Definitely check out Ropp, Chacom, and Genod pipes. Really hard to go wrong with French factory brands. Cheap, well made, good smokers. Only real downside is they don't always have the best grain. I would recommend either the Ropp Vintage lines (Sandblast or Superior) with the horn stems. The buttons are a little chunky but not uncomfortable. That said almost any of the pipes by those 3 brands will do right by you. Also for some of the Ropps (Etudian line) you can get 2 pipes for the $100.
